Avamere At Newberg offers competitive pricing for its accommodations compared to both Yamhill County and the broader state of Oregon. For a Studio apartment, residents will find the monthly cost at Avamere At Newberg to be $2,817, significantly lower than the county average of $4,837 and the state average of $3,815. The 1 Bedroom option is also priced attractively at $2,941, while Yamhill County's average stands at $4,069 and Oregon's average is slightly higher at $3,904. In terms of Semi-Private rooms, Avamere charges $4,027 - again below the county's rate of $5,075 and the state's rate of $4,457. Overall, Avamere At Newberg provides an appealing financial advantage for those seeking quality senior living in a well-priced environment.

Avamere at Newberg's assisted living facility has received mostly positive feedback from visitors and family members of residents. One individual praised the facility for their excellent communication with both residents and family members. They mentioned that the staff was attentive and involved residents in daily activities and projects, creating a lively social atmosphere. Another person highly recommended Avamere at Newberg, emphasizing the care and compassion provided to their mother.
Although one reviewer stated that their husband had only been at the facility for a short time, they expressed satisfaction with the level of care he was receiving. They mentioned that he shared a room with another resident and that there were activities available on Fridays, providing some form of engagement for him.
A visitor praised Avamere at Newberg for their caring staff and numerous activities offered to residents. The person noted that the facility was clean and well-maintained, with options for shopping and various entertainment options such as cards, bingo, puzzles, exercise, and live music performances. However, they did mention concerns about items going missing or not being fixed promptly.
Another reviewer shared that Avamere was referred to them by a hospital social worker for their father's care needs. They expressed satisfaction with the facility overall, noting cleanliness and good conditions. The reviewer mentioned that their father had gained weight since moving in due to the availability of multiple meal choices beyond what was officially offered. However, they also expressed concern about inconsistent transfer techniques among staff members which affected their father's comfort due to his preference for routine.
One family member pointed out some issues they encountered regarding essential medication not being reordered promptly and an incident where their grandmother was sent to the hospital without anyone on her contact list being notified. Despite these concerns, they acknowledged their grandmother's overall happiness during her time there.
The physical layout of Avamere at Newberg was described as having private rooms for assisted living residents alongside one-bedroom apartments or studios with kitchenettes. The facility's decor was commended for its warm and personalized feel. The communal areas, such as the foyer and sitting areas, were well-utilized by residents for activities and socializing.
The dining area was noted for its impressive ambiance, resembling a nice restaurant, and offering a rotating menu with daily selections. Music concerts were frequently held in common areas, attracting enthusiastic attendance. Memory care residents had access to a secure garden area for outdoor activities.
While the memory care unit's staff received positive feedback for their attentiveness and engaging activities, turnover among administrative staff on the assisted living side seemed to have affected the quality of care. Incidents of patient falls resulted in some staff members being let go. It was also mentioned that there is generally a low ratio of caregivers to residents.
Overall, Avamere at Newberg seems suitable for individuals requiring a lower level of care but may not be ideal for those needing more extensive assistance. The cost was deemed to be in the mid-to-upper range compared to other facilities in the area.

Medicaid waivers for assisted living services provide vital support for seniors and individuals with disabilities in need of long-term care, with varying state-specific eligibility criteria and benefits. These waivers cover personal care and case management but often do not fully cover room and board, leading to waiting lists for many applicants.
